Is Nature Valley Packed Sustained Energy Bar Peanut Butter & Cranberry Vegan?

No. This product is not vegan as it lists 3 ingredients that derive from animals and 1 ingredient could could derive from animals depending on the source. We recommend contacting the manufacturer directly to confirm.

Ingredients

Peanut Butter (peanuts, salt), Honey, Sugar, Whole Grain Oats, Cranberries, Roasted Peanuts, Sunflower Seeds, Pumpkin Seeds, Tapioca Syrup, Rice Flour, Palm and Palm Kernel Oil, Peanut Flour, Coconut, Calcium Caseinate, Vegetable Glycerin, Canola Oil, Whey Protein Isolate, Salt, Fructose, Almond Butter (almonds), Barley Malt Extract, Baking Soda. Contains Peanut, Coconut, Milk, Almond; May Contain Cashew, Soy and Wheat Ingredients.

What is a Vegan diet?

A vegan diet excludes all animal-derived foods, including meat, poultry, fish, dairy, eggs, and honey. It focuses on plant-based sources such as fruits, vegetables, grains, legumes, nuts, and seeds. Many people choose veganism for ethical, environmental, or health reasons. When well-planned, it provides sufficient protein, fiber, and antioxidants, though supplementation or fortified foods may be needed for nutrients like vitamin B12, iron, and omega-3 fatty acids. Vegan diets are associated with lower risks of heart disease and improved digestion but require mindfulness to ensure balanced and complete nutrition.
